Best Dystopian YA Fiction: What Are the Must - Read Titles?

One great dystopian YA fiction is 'The Hunger Games' by Suzanne Collins. It's set in a post - apocalyptic world where children are forced to fight to the death in an annual event for the entertainment of the Capitol. Another is 'Divergent' by Veronica Roth. In this story, society is divided into factions based on different virtues. And 'The Maze Runner' by James Dashner is also a great one, where a group of boys are trapped in a maze with no memory of their past.

Best Books 2023 Fiction: What are some must - read titles?

One of the great 2023 fiction books is 'Trust'. It offers a complex exploration of power, wealth, and relationships through multiple perspectives. Another is 'Demon Copperhead' which is a modern take on 'David Copperfield' and tells a powerful story of a boy's struggle in Appalachia. And 'The Covenant of Water' is also notable for its beautiful storytelling about family across generations.

Must Read Christian Fiction: What Are Some of the Best Titles?

Definitely check out 'A Lineage of Grace' by Francine Rivers. It tells the stories of five women in Jesus' lineage in a very engaging way. 'The Screwtape Letters' by C.S. Lewis is also a must - read. It gives insights into how the devil tries to tempt people away from God through the letters of a senior demon to a junior one. 'The Mark of the Lion' series by Francine Rivers is great too as it shows the early Christian church in the Roman Empire.
